Did the "labor dispute" between the Players and the League disappear when the players decertified as a union and elected to pursue the dispute through antitrust litigation rather than collective bargaining?
Whatever the effect of the union's decertification may have on the League's immunity from antitrust liability, the "labor dispute" did not suddenly disappear just because the Players elected to pursue the dispute through antitrust litigation rather than collective bargaining.
